Where rice grows, coconuts often grow too. In a rice landscape, the islands of darker green are the crowns of coconut trees which shade the villages beneath. The large number of recipes in this book that use coconut may reflect the importance of coconuts in tropical cuisines, or it may just be nostalgia for the fields and groves I lived among as a child.
